    In this episode of AI Diatribe, host Jason Lowe (JLowe) sits down with David McPeak, President of Sky Data Vault, to explore why we're still in the early days of AI transformation - and why the biggest changes are yet to come.

    David brings a unique perspective from the infrastructure trenches, having built and sold multiple companies while watching technology evolve from mainframes to cloud services to today's AI revolution. He shares insights on the critical security challenges most companies are overlooking as they integrate AI with their data, the coming wave of AI agents that will manage other AI agents, and why the current gap between AI "haves and have-nots" is about to disappear. Key topics covered:

    - Why AI without proper security is "just a very efficient threat vector"

    - The infrastructure challenges companies face as they move from cloud-only back to hybrid models

    - How AI agents will accelerate business processes beyond human comprehension

    - The economic disruption coming when AI drives costs toward zero

    - Practical advice for individuals and businesses just getting started with AI

    Executives know AI is coming - but the million-dollar question remains: Do you wait, or do you act now? In this episode, we bring Game Theory into the boardroom to explore how business leaders are being forced into strategic decisions with incomplete information, unpredictable competitors, and massive potential upside - or downside.Jason Lowe, Chad Muckenfuss and Trevor Burnside break down what Game Theory really is, drawing on classics like the Prisoner’s Dilemma. From there, we dissect how today’s AI adoption decisions mirror those classic standoffs - and where companies might be bluffing, hedging, or charging in.We dive into:* Whether today’s executive mindset mirrors a high-stakes coordination game* What it means to signal innovation without truly embracing it* The risks of waiting too long... and the risks of moving too fast* Where irrationality creeps in—even when the math is clear* Tactical advice: What every leadership team should do right now to stay in the gameWhether you’re a strategist, technologist, or just AI-curious, this one’s a sharp, strategic dive into the hidden dynamics shaping the future of business.
